The beginning of Hill's Pet Food Company

The Company inspired by a guide dog
In 1943, his ideas were visionary in veterinary medicine. Dr. Mark L. Morris, Sr., a veterinary surgeon, believed certain diseases in pets could be managed through carefully formulated nutrition.
The chance to prove his theory came when a young blind man named Morris Frank asked Dr. Morris if anything could be done to save his guide dog, Buddy, who was suffering from kidney failure. Dr. Morris, decided to put the dog on a special diet. Because his kidneys were failing, he carefully reduced the levels of protein and minerals he believed were associated with Buddy's problems. The improvement was dramatic.
The result of Dr. Morris' efforts was the nutritional formulation that would become the first Hill's Prescription Diet product, and the world's first pet food designed to help dogs with kidney disease.
Soon after, Hill's Pet Nutrition was founded and the field of clinical nutrition was a brand new industry.
